Rotograph D - White Image 0%

Updated: 06/21/2017
Article #: 104


See the following how to troubleshoot white image 0% for Rotograph D

 

 

If you have all options enable in configuration menu (see below) you will be able to see % on the final image as seen below.

If the image shows 0% and x-ray is white as shown, we must determine if 1) there is no emission from the tube or 2) sensor /

sensor cables have an issue. 

 

 

First check to see if the machine is emitting radiation via a fluorescent screen (n. 6108910100) or intensifying screen. 
- If the machine is not emitting x-ray, see the following article for No Exposure Troubleshooting. 
- If the machine is emitting x-ray, follow the steps here below

 

1. Find the PANORAMIX_DLL.INI file in program files or program data directory
2. Set GENERATE_PAN_FILE=1 and save
3. Tape the copper plate (n. 5807900800) to the sensor cover opening completely covering the open slot in the cover. 


4. Have a staff member insert the knobs of the black round centering tool into the chin rest

(remove the bite stick first - drawing attached)


5. Take a pano with copper plate on the sensor and round tool in chinrest
6. In the PC look for a .pan file (file starts with PUSB)
7. Send the .pan file to Villa representative along with the regular image file for analysis

8. If you are onsite, you may check the fuses of the sensor board (3 small fuses seen below). If fuses are ok, a Villa

representative may suggest you connect a new N2 Signal Cable n. 6208532000 (harness running through arm to 

the sensor board).
